Architectural Wonder in the Mountains
The Tschuggen Grand Hotel is instantly recognizable for its striking design by Swiss architect Mario Botta. Known as the Tschuggen Bergoase Spa, its glass “sails” rise from the mountainside like shimmering ice formations, creating a landmark that blends seamlessly into the alpine landscape. Inside, guests are greeted by warm wood, expansive windows, and a modern aesthetic that balances cozy alpine charm with sophisticated elegance. Each suite and guest room offers sweeping mountain views, where mornings are framed by snowy peaks or rolling green hills, depending on the season.

Adventure Beyond the Hotel
Of course, luxury at Tschuggen extends beyond the walls of the hotel. In winter, guests can step directly onto the hotel’s private mountain railway, the Tschuggen Express, which whisks them to the ski slopes of Arosa Lenzerheide in under four minutes. This seamless access makes skiing a delight, free from crowds and long lines. In summer, the surrounding valleys transform into a hiker’s paradise, with trails leading to crystal-clear lakes and alpine meadows in bloom. Mountain biking, golf, and paragliding offer further thrills for those who seek adventure in the fresh alpine air.

Q&A: Other Hotels Worth Considering in Switzerland
Q: Are there other alpine luxury hotels in Switzerland similar to Tschuggen Grand Hotel?
A: Yes, several properties across the Swiss Alps offer comparable elegance. The Chedi Andermatt combines Asian-inspired design with alpine warmth, featuring an expansive spa and renowned dining. The Kulm Hotel St. Moritz offers timeless grandeur with a history tied to the birth of winter tourism. Meanwhile, Badrutt’s Palace Hotel in St. Moritz remains iconic for its blend of tradition and sophistication.
Q: Where should I stay if I want a more secluded mountain experience?
A: For those who prefer quiet seclusion, the Alpina Gstaad offers understated luxury and stunning mountain views, while the Whitepod Eco-Luxury Hotel near Monthey provides an eco-conscious glamping experience in futuristic pods set high in the Alps.
Q: Are there alpine resorts with a stronger wellness focus?
A: Yes, the Grand Resort Bad Ragaz is internationally recognized for its healing thermal waters and wellness programs. It offers a medically integrated spa experience alongside luxury hospitality, making it perfect for those who prioritize rejuvenation.
